Overview

The nVent HDP58MDHSS InterSafe Data Interface Port is a critical component designed to enhance safety and efficiency in industrial automation environments. Manufactured by nVent, a trusted leader in enclosure solutions, this interface port (SKU: HDP58MDHSS) provides secure and convenient programming access to devices housed within industrial enclosures without the need to open the enclosure door. This feature significantly reduces the risk of operator exposure to energized components, a paramount concern in maintaining workplace safety and adhering to stringent industrial safety standards. Engineered with robust Type 304 stainless steel, the HDP58MDHSS offers exceptional durability and corrosion resistance, making it suitable for demanding industrial applications where harsh environmental conditions are common. Its construction ensures longevity and reliable performance, even in challenging settings such as chemical plants, food and beverage processing facilities, and outdoor installations. The 8-pole configuration and Mini DIN connection type are specifically designed to interface with Data Highway Plus and Duplex communication systems, ensuring seamless integration with existing industrial networks. Many configurations of the InterSafe Data Interface Port are standard and readily available, allowing for quick deployment to meet diverse application requirements and programming needs. This versatility minimizes downtime and streamlines the setup process for automation engineers and maintenance personnel. The primary function of this interface is to facilitate direct communication with Programmable Logic Controllers (PLCs) or other intelligent devices installed inside an enclosure. This allows for tasks such as program uploads and downloads, parameter adjustments, diagnostics, and real-time monitoring without compromising the integrity of the enclosure's environmental protection (e.g., NEMA or IP ratings).   • Steel and Stainless Steel doors are welded and ground
  • Back plate is aluminum
  • All standard configurations include a GFCI or standard duplex receptacle with a 5-A circuit breaker for added safety
  • Door gasket (between the door and plate assemblies) and plate gasket (between the plate assembly and the enclosure) together provide a tight seal
  • Template provided for accurate enclosure cutout dimensions
  • Quarter-turn latch with screwdriver slot and padlock hasp on all steel and stainless steel door models for convenience and security
  • Quarter-turn latch with screwdriver slot on polycarbonate models

The NE1.5X4WH6 Halogen-Free Wide Slot Wiring Duct design provides greater rigidity and allows for a wide range of wire/bundle sizes. Upper and lower scorelines for easy finger/sidewall section removal. UL 94 flame class of V-0 with a UL recognized continuous-use temperature up to 95 C (203 F). Halogen-Free, Polyphenylene Oxide (PPO). Mounting holes provided. 4.06" x 1.64" (103.1 mm x 41.7 mm) and 6' (1.83 m) long. Cover sold separately. Color White. 6 pieces per package.

The NNC75X75WH2 Halogen-Free Wide Slot Wiring Duct is used to route, protect, and manage wires near sensitive electronic equipment and in environments where heat resistance or public safety is a concern. UL 94 flame class of V-0 with a UL recognized continuous-use temperature up to 95 C (203 F). Halogen-Free, Polyphenylene Oxide (PPO). Mounting holes provided. 2.85" x 2.97" (72.4 mm x 75.4 mm) and 6.6' (2 m) long. Cover included. Color White. 5 pieces per package.

Frequently Asked Questions about nVent

What industries and applications are nVent products used for?

nVent products are engineered for critical infrastructure and industrial applications across multiple demanding sectors. Key markets include Construction, Data Centers, Defense, Healthcare, Mining, Oil & Gas Refineries, Power Plants, Rail/Transit, Renewable Energy, Security, Ship Building, Steel Mills, Telecom, and Utilities. Their solutions are designed to withstand extreme environmental conditions, with temperature ranges from -55°C to 105°C and specialized features like UV resistance, oil resistance, and flame resistance.

What environmental ratings do nVent products have?

nVent enclosures feature comprehensive environmental ratings, including UL 508A, CSA, and NEMA Type 1, 2, 3, 4, 4X, 12, and 13 certifications. They are rated IEC 60529 IP66, providing robust protection against dust, water, and corrosion in both indoor and outdoor environments. These products operate effectively in temperatures ranging from -40°F to 266°F, with enhanced UV inhibitors for outdoor weathering and oil-resistant gaskets for superior sealing.

What is nVent's warranty policy?

nVent offers a standard 18-month warranty from invoicing date for most automation products, covering defects in workmanship and materials. The warranty requires proper transportation, handling, storage, and installation within specified environmental conditions. Warranty coverage includes repair or replacement at nVent's discretion, with certain conditions such as authorized service repairs and operation within designed capacity limits.
